You cannot see this page without javascript.

요청하신 정보를 상세히 분석 중입니다...
Q. 지금 답변 내용은 학습된 data 자료에서 추론한 답변인지 아니면 어떻게 답변을 하는것인지 알려줘
1. LLM은 학습 데이터 기반 패턴 예측으로 답변 생성. 2. LLM 작동 방식: 입력 텍스트를 토큰화하여 모델에 전달. 토큰은 단어, 구두점, 또는 단어의 일부분일 수 있음. 모델은 입력된 토큰을 벡터 임베딩으로 변환하여 텍스트의 의미와 문맥 파악. 어텐션 메커니즘을 사용하여 문장 내 단어 간의 관계 분석 및 장거리 의존성 파악. 디코딩 전략을 통해 다음에 올 단어 예측 및 텍스트 생성. 다양한 디코딩 전략 존재: - Greedy Search: 가장 확률이 높은 단어 선택. - Beam Search: 여러 가능한 단어 시퀀스 고려. - Top-k Sampling: 상위 k개 확률이 높은 단어에서 샘플링. 생성된 텍스트는 문맥에 맞춰 일관성 있는 결과물을 생성. 3. 학습 과정: 대량의 텍스트 데이터책, 기사, 웹사이트 등를 사용하여 사전 훈련. 데이터 과학자는 오류, 중복, 불필요한 콘텐츠 제거를 위해 데이터 정제 및 전처리 진행. 모델은 unsupervised learning을 통해 단어 간의 통계적 관계와 문맥 학습. 특정 작업번역, 요약 등에 맞게 labeled 데이터로 fine-tuning 진행. Reinforcement learning from human feedback RLHF를 사용하여 모델 출력을 개선. 4. 샘플링은 LLM이 텍스트를 생성하는 핵심 과정이며, 확률 분포를 기반으로 다음에 올 단어토큰를 선택. 모델은 입력 분석 후 어휘집의 각 단어에 대한 점수 목록인 로짓 벡터를 계산. 점수는 softmax 함수를 거쳐 확률로 변환되고, 모델은 이 확률을 기반으로 다음 토큰을 선택. 5. LLM은 텍스트 생성 시 다양한 기술 활용: Transformer 모델: self-attention 메커니즘을 사용하여 단어 간의 관계와 문맥 이해. Autoregressive 모델: 훈련 데이터에서 얻은 예측을 기반으로 응답에 가장 적합한 단어 결정. Deep learning: neural networks를 사용하여 훈련 데이터에 대한 자체 응답을 분석하고 더 나은 답변을 제공하는 방법 학습. 6. LLM은 방대한 텍스트 데이터에서 패턴을 학습하고, 학습된 패턴을 기반으로 다음에 올 단어나 아이디어를 예측하여 답변을 생성. LLM은 정보를 암기하는 대신, 언어 자체에 내재된 패턴을 학습하고 단어 간의 연결, 아이디어 구성 방식 등을 학습. 7. LLM의 한계: Hallucination: 모델이 거짓 또는 오해의 소지가 있는 정보 생성. Bias: 훈련 데이터에 존재하는 편향 반영. 높은 계산 비용. 8. 텍스트 생성 종류: Open-ended 텍스트 생성: 주어진 프롬프트를 기반으로 새로운 텍스트 생성. 요약: 긴 텍스트의 축약 버전 생성. 번역: 한 언어에서 다른 언어로 텍스트 변환. Question Answering: 질문에 대한 답변 생성.